### How Websites Track and Identify You
You might wonder how platforms even know it's you. It's not just about your login credentials. Every time you go online, your browser leaves behind a unique fingerprint. This includes things like your screen resolution, installed fonts, time zone, and even your browser's specific version. Websites collect dozens of these data points to create a profile that's as unique as your actual fingerprint.
When you log into multiple accounts from the same browser, even with different usernames and passwords, these platforms can connect the dots. They see the identical fingerprint and flag it as suspicious activity—often leading to those dreaded suspensions. ### The Core Technology Behind the Scenes
So, how do anti-detect browsers break this chain? They work by spoofing or masking these digital fingerprints. For every profile you create, the browser generates a completely new set of parameters. One profile might appear to be running on a Windows 11 machine with a 1920x1080 screen from New York. Another, seconds later, could look like a MacBook user in Los Angeles with a different set of plugins.
It's not just about changing one or two settings. A robust anti-detect solution manipulates hundreds of data points simultaneously. This creates authentic, isolated environments that platforms perceive as separate, legitimate users. It's the difference between a cheap Halloween mask and a Hollywood-grade prosthetic.

### Key Features That Make a Difference
Not all anti-detection tools are created equal. When you're evaluating options for 2026 and beyond, look for these critical features:
- **Fingerprint Spoofing:** The ability to consistently and convincingly alter browser, canvas, WebGL, and audio fingerprints.
- **Proxy Integration:** Seamless support for residential and mobile proxies to mask your real IP address. This is non-negotiable.
- **Profile Isolation:** True separation between profiles, with no data leakage or cookie sharing.
- **Automation Capabilities:** Built-in tools or easy integration with automation software for scaling your operations.
- **Team Collaboration:** Features that allow secure profile sharing and management among team members without compromising security.

### Looking Ahead to 2026 and Beyond
The technology is evolving rapidly. Detection systems are incorporating more advanced machine learning to spot patterns humans would miss. In response, the next generation of anti-detect browsers is moving beyond simple spoofing. They're beginning to use behavioral emulation—mimicking human-like mouse movements, typing rhythms, and browsing patterns to appear even more authentic.
